About the project

At BEAM Consulting and Research, we have collected and analyzed social media visibility data and e-marketing work for the Iqraa Language Scale, a standardized test that seeks to measure the Arabic language competencies of non-native speakers, and is like choosing IELTS and TOEFL in English, as it targets the application of the scale at the international level for students wishing to study areas that require Arabic language, or students wishing to study in Arabic countries, as well as individuals wishing to work and prove their proficiency in the Arabic language.

The main objectives of the project

Monitor social media engagement with scale activities and posts. Know the impact of measurement posts on social media on visibility, follow-up, engagement, and other statistics. Develop and improve the published content and its presentation based on the results. Monitoring and following up reference accounts in the same field and comparing performance with them.

The project Outputs

Collect and analyze data for 3 social media platforms for the scale. Develop 3 new strategies based on analysis to increase and raise results. The scale's Twitter account became on the list of the first 3 results to appear in the Google search engine.
